**Q: What happens to idempotency keys during a payment retry storm?**

On Ledgewick Pay, each charge attempt carries a client-generated idempotency key that persists for 72 hours. Retries with the same key return the original outcome rather than creating duplicate charges, even across region failover. Before cutting a release, confirm the key TTL matches the retry backoff ceiling in the gateway config. If the key store itself is sealed after an incident, unseal it with the recovery passphrase below:

vault phrase of faduf-bajep = tamius-rusox-holok-kasdor-rusdor-druius-giliel-ulaox-zoriel

- [ ] **Step 7: Breaker override escrow.** After sealing the signing keys for the Tallgrove upstream API circuit breaker, confirm the support team can force the breaker open during a full outage. The override bundle lives in the sealed escrow drawer and is useless without its unlock phrase. Two ceremony witnesses must initial this step before proceeding. The escrow bundle is decrypted with the recovery passphrase that follows.

vault phrase of kahip-kahop = holath-quenmir

# Runbook: Hunting leaked file descriptors in Quillgate

When the `fd_open` gauge climbs steadily between deploys, suspect a leak rather than load. First confirm on a single pod: exec in and count entries under `/proc/1/fd`, noting how many are sockets in CLOSE_WAIT versus regular files. Capture two snapshots ten minutes apart before restarting anything — we need the delta for the postmortem. Reproduce locally with the Marbury load harness, which requires the service running with the following configuration values.

settings of yagep-bajog:
[istdor]
port = 4000
region = south-2
host = istdor.qorvelcorp.internal
timeout_ms = 5000
retries = 5

The Dunmere pipeline pins a static-analysis baseline file per release branch. Purpose: new findings block merge; baselined findings don't. The baseline is generated only by the provenance-signed CI job — hand-edited baselines are rejected at verification. Regenerate via the `baseline-refresh` stage; it commits with a bot signature and records the source revision. If the baseline and branch head diverge, the release gate fails closed. Current baseline for this release cycle was produced by the build identified below.

session token of kageg-tahop = htk14_af3c1ccccb7dcf